Kidlington Porch Installation (OX5): In relation to this short article, a porch is a one-storey, covered architectural feature that projects out from a home or structure in Kidlington, that can be completely enclosed or partly open to the elements. A porch is a reasonably cost-effective way to reduce draughts, create some extra space and add some character to an otherwise drab wall on a residential property. By and large a porch is constructed over the front entrance to a property or home.

Free Kidlington Porch Building Quotes

When such an architectural structure in the United Kingdom is open, it is sometimes known as a canopy in the UK. Around the globe there are several different styles of porches including lanais, porticos, sleeping porches, verandas, screened porches, loggias, rain porches and sun porches.

Do I Require Planning Permission for a Porch? As long as particular requirements are observed, planning permission is rarely required for the installation of a porch on an external door of your home in Kidlington. This holds true if: 1. No component of the porch is more than 3m above ground level. 2. The exterior ground floor area of the construction is not more than 3m2. 3. No section of the construction is within 2m of any highway or 2m from the boundary of the property. 4. Your residence is a house, and not a flat, maisonette or other form of building. Your local planning department should be approached before you press ahead with any porch building. You'll be able to get some advice and guidance regarding this from your Kidlington building contractor.

Porches and the Building Regulations: You can likewise avoid the necessity for building regulations approval provided that the existing exterior door is not taken out, any disability access is preserved and the porch area is lower than 30m2 and is at ground level. Electrical and glazing regulations do however should still be adhered to at all times. Once again, for all advice pertaining to regulations, talk to your chosen builder or to the local planning office.

Types of Porch Awnings in Kidlington

Porch awnings are an excellent choice for those looking to enhance their outdoor space in Kidlington. Not only do they offer protection from the elements, but they also add a stylish touch to your porch, patios, or decks. It's a common misconception that installing awnings is a costly undertaking. The truth is, you don't need to spend a fortune to have one installed.

Choosing the right style of porch awnings for your property is essential to ensure that you get the most out of your outdoor space. Fixed awnings are perfect if you want a permanent shade for your porch, while retractable porch awnings offer more flexibility, allowing you to move them around as needed. With automatic operation, you can adjust your awnings with the touch of a button from the comfort of your own home. Alternatively, for those who want the ultimate in convenience, there are models with built-in sensors that can detect high winds and automatically retract the awnings to prevent damage.

If you have restricted space between the gate and your home's door, you can install a canopy awning above your door. This will prevent rainwater from entering your house in times of heavy rainfall. Canopy awnings also serve as sun shades outside your door in any kind of Kidlington weather.

Installing porch awnings is a great way to take control of the weather outside your home. Not only do they offer shade on sunny days, but they also provide protection from snow and rain during colder months. Additionally, porch awnings add a sophisticated touch to your outdoor space and help keep your home's interior cool during sunny weather. Fixed awning installation can even protect your outdoor furniture, preventing sun damage and extending the life of your carpets, rugs, and other furnishings.

Porch and patio awnings are versatile and adaptable, making them suitable for a wide range of structures. Whether you want to match the colour or style of your home, there are many different types of awnings to choose from. With materials ranging from fabric to corrugated polycarbonate, fibreglass or aluminum, you can select the ideal awning to suit your preferences and budget. If you're worried about the cost of installation and labour, you can even purchase awnings from hardware stores and take on a DIY project, allowing you to exercise your creativity while designing your own unique awnings for your property. Porticos

A portico is the entrance of a building that is both charming and functional, and it has been around for centuries. A covered structure supported by pillars or columns that extends from the facade of a building is called a portico. This structure is taken from the Latin word "porticus," which means porch or entrance. Porticos are stylish and welcoming entryways that frequently provide shelter from the weather and impart a sense of magnificence to the building's design.

Porticos are known for their complex design elements, which can include decorative mouldings, pediments and friezes. These decorative features not only highlight the craftsmanship of the period when the structure was built but also add a hint of refinement and elegance. The ornate details of the portico are highlighted by the interplay of light and shadow, making it more visually interesting.

Historically, porticos have been prevalent in a number of architectural styles, from ancient Roman and Greek temples to neoclassical and colonial structures. These distinctive architectural features often hold symbolic significance, serving as visual cues of significance and importance. The styles of portico columns vary, from the archetypal Doric, Ionic, and Corinthian orders of classical architecture to more modern and simplified designs.

A portico's main purpose is to provide protection and shelter for those leaving or entering a building, and this is one of its main functions. Porticos are particularly beneficial in places with changeable weather conditions, owing to their practical function. The portico offers a comfortable place to shelter from the elements before entering the building. The ability of porticos to provide shade during hot, sunny days, as well as shelter from the rain, makes them a versatile architectural feature. (58731 - Porticos Kidlington)
